1. Topography
Topography is a foundational aspect of any cartographic illustration of the Sangre de Cristo Mountains in Colorado. The bodily form and options of the land, encompassing elevation adjustments, slope gradients, and the association of pure formations, are immediately visualized via topographic mapping. The presence of steep peaks, deep valleys, and expansive plains inside the mountain vary dictates the contour strains and shading used on a bodily map. For instance, intently spaced contour strains point out a steep ascent, whereas broadly spaced strains denote a mild slope. The correct depiction of those topographic traits is essential for varied functions.

Contour Traces and Topographic Profiles
Elevation knowledge is usually visualized via contour strains, which join factors of equal elevation. These strains create a visible illustration of the terrain’s form, permitting customers to shortly determine peaks, valleys, and slopes. Topographic profiles, derived from elevation knowledge, present a side-view perspective of the terrain alongside a selected line, additional illustrating elevation adjustments. For example, planning a climbing route throughout the Sangre de Cristo Mountains necessitates cautious examination of contour strains to evaluate the steepness and total problem of the path.
-
Digital Elevation Fashions (DEMs)
Digital Elevation Fashions (DEMs) characterize elevation knowledge as a grid of values, every equivalent to a selected geographic location. DEMs can be utilized to generate three-dimensional visualizations of the terrain, offering a sensible illustration of the Sangre de Cristo Mountains. These fashions are invaluable for scientific analysis, corresponding to hydrological modeling to foretell water movement patterns or analyzing potential avalanche paths. Moreover, DEMs type the idea for creating shaded reduction maps, which improve the visible illustration of the terrain by simulating the consequences of daylight.

5. Land Possession
The depiction of land possession on a cartographic illustration of the Sangre de Cristo Mountains in Colorado immediately influences permitted actions, entry rules, and conservation efforts inside the area. Public lands, non-public property, and guarded areas every carry distinct guidelines that govern utilization. Correct delineation of those boundaries on the geographic reference is, subsequently, important for authorized compliance, accountable recreation, and efficient useful resource administration. The failure to acknowledge land possession boundaries can result in trespassing violations, useful resource injury, and conflicts between completely different consumer teams.
For instance, a map could differentiate between Nationwide Forest land, the place dispersed tenting and climbing are usually permitted, and personal ranch land, the place entry is restricted to licensed personnel. Equally, Wilderness Areas, designated for preservation, typically have stricter rules relating to motorcar use and path upkeep in comparison with different public lands. Discrepancies between a illustration and precise land possession can result in unintentional violations of rules, doubtlessly leading to fines or different authorized penalties. Furthermore, understanding land possession is significant for conservation planning. Coordinating conservation efforts throughout a number of possession boundaries requires clear communication and cooperation amongst completely different stakeholders. Conservation easements, as an illustration, are authorized agreements that prohibit growth on non-public land to guard pure sources. The presence and site of such easements have to be precisely mirrored on a geographic depiction to make sure their enforcement and effectiveness.

7. Geological Formations
The geological formations represent a elementary layer of data on any helpful geographic depiction of the Sangre de Cristo Mountains in Colorado. The underlying rock sorts, structural options (faults, folds), and surficial deposits immediately affect the topography, hydrology, and ecological patterns of the mountain vary. The map turns into considerably extra precious by incorporating geological knowledge, enabling knowledgeable decision-making throughout varied fields, from useful resource extraction to hazard evaluation. For example, the presence of particular rock formations could point out the potential for mineral deposits, guiding exploration efforts. Conversely, figuring out unstable geological buildings, corresponding to fault strains, is essential for mitigating earthquake dangers and planning infrastructure growth.
The sensible implications of understanding the connection between geological formations and geographical options are multifaceted. Detailed maps figuring out completely different rock items, like Precambrian granite, Paleozoic sedimentary rocks, or Tertiary volcanic rocks, allow geologists to interpret the mountain vary’s tectonic historical past and predict its future evolution. Information of geological buildings additionally informs hazard assessments associated to landslides, rockfalls, and particles flows. For instance, areas with steep slopes and fractured rock are inherently extra susceptible to mass losing occasions. Correct maps illustrating these zones facilitate the implementation of mitigation measures, corresponding to slope stabilization or managed blasting, to scale back the danger of property injury and lack of life. Query 3: What are the first sources of knowledge used to create geographic references of the Sangre de Cristo Mountains?
Information sources embody america Geological Survey (USGS) for topographic knowledge, the US Forest Service (USFS) and Bureau of Land Administration (BLM) for land possession and path info, aerial and satellite tv for pc imagery for land cowl and have extraction, and subject surveys for verifying and supplementing current knowledge.

Navigating the Sangre de Cristo Mountains
Using representations of the Sangre de Cristo Mountains in Colorado necessitates cautious consideration. The next suggestions define essential components to make sure protected and efficient use of those sources.
Tip 1: Confirm Information Forex: Earlier than counting on geographical knowledge for planning or navigation, verify its publication or revision date. Outdated info could not precisely replicate present path circumstances, highway closures, or land possession boundaries.
Tip 2: Cross-Reference A number of Sources: Examine info from a number of geographical references, together with authorities company web sites (USFS, BLM) and commercially obtainable merchandise. Discrepancies ought to immediate additional investigation to find out essentially the most dependable knowledge.
Tip 3: Perceive Scale and Decision: Concentrate on the map’s scale and determination. Smaller-scale maps present a broad overview however could lack element, whereas larger-scale maps supply better precision for localized navigation.
Tip 4: Account for Seasonal Variations: Acknowledge that circumstances within the Sangre de Cristo Mountains range considerably all year long. Seasonal highway closures, snow cowl, and water availability can impression accessibility and security. Confirm present circumstances with native authorities earlier than embarking on a visit.
Tip 5: Make the most of GPS Expertise Properly: Whereas GPS gadgets can improve navigation, they shouldn’t be solely relied upon. Battery failures, sign loss, and inaccurate knowledge can happen. At all times carry a backup illustration and possess the abilities to navigate utilizing conventional strategies (compass, map studying).
Tip 6: Heed Land Possession Boundaries: Respect non-public property and cling to rules governing entry to public lands. Trespassing can lead to authorized penalties and injury relationships between landowners and leisure customers. Seek the advice of detailed land possession maps to keep away from unintentional violations.
Tip 7: Assess Topographic Element: Consider how topographic knowledge is represented. Contour strains, shading, and elevation factors convey terrain info. Understanding these representations assists in route planning and hazard avoidance, corresponding to figuring out steep slopes or potential avalanche zones.
